Audi R10 TDI: ALMS participation reconfirmed!

Audi R10
We reported that Audi re-checked their ALMS participation after the victorious Sebring race due to the lack of real competition. Today we can happpily inform you that Audi reconfirmed its participation in ALMS! Great day for all race enthusiasts.
Audi reconfirmed its plans today to contest the balance of the 2007 American Le Mans Series season beginning with this weekend's Acura Sports Car Challenge of St. Petersburg. The German manufacturer is trying for its eighth consecutive LMP1 championship with a pair of diesel-powered R10 TDIs that are unbeaten in eight American Le Mans Series starts plus a win last season at the 24 Hours of Le Mans.

Audi will battle prototypes from Acura, Porsche, Lola, Creation and Mazda for the overall victory this weekend.

"The diesel racing commitment in the American Le Mans Series is important for promoting diesel engines in America," said Dr. Wolfgang Ullrich, Head of Audi Motorsport. "That's why we decided to continue competing in the American Le Mans Series."
